Abstract

This study aims to reveal the values ​​of Islamic education contained in the tradition of childbirth. This study uses a qualitative approach with a case study method in Sidomukti village, Banyuasin Regency, South Sumatra. The study subjects included parents who had just given birth, community leaders, and religious leaders selected through purposive sampling techniques. Data were collected through in-depth interviews, participant observation, and document analysis. The study had three main findings. First, birth traditions such as aqiqah and naming reflect the values ​​of Islamic education, gratitude to Allah, and a commitment to instilling spiritual values ​​from an early age. Second, the involvement of religious leaders in naming emphasizes the importance of religious guidance in children's education, which is seen as the beginning of the formation of Islamic character. Third, the Thanksgiving event after the aqiqah is a forum for strengthening social ties, delivering religious advice to parents, and strengthening community support in children's education. In conclusion, the birth tradition in Sidomukti is not only a social ritual but also a medium for character and spiritual education based on Islamic values. This study recommends integrating these values ​​into formal and non-formal education curricula to support forming a generation with Islamic character and high spiritual awareness

Abstract

One of the most critical competencies a teacher must possess is effectively assessing learning. To achieve this, prospective teachers need to develop the skill of crafting high-quality questions that meet three essential criteria: alignment with learning objectives, the capacity to measure higher-order cognitive skills, and the use of precise and clear question narratives. This study focuses on implementing portfolio assessment in the Islamic Religious Education (PAI) learning evaluation course, which aims to improve students' ability to make questions as a tool in learning evaluation. The research adopts a qualitative approach, specifically Classroom Action Research (CAR), to explore the impact of this intervention. The findings of this study reveal significant improvements in students' ability to formulate questions, as measured by three key indicators. First, students demonstrated a marked progression in their ability to create questions that align with learning objectives, advancing from the "poor" category to the "very good" category. Second, there was a notable shift in the cognitive level of the questions produced, with students moving from constructing questions that targeted lower-order thinking skills (levels 1-2) to those that engaged medium-level cognitive processes (levels 3-4). Third, students exhibited a substantial enhancement in their ability to compose question narratives that are both precise and clear, transitioning from an initial "poor" categorization to a "very good" level of proficiency. Therefore, the study concludes that integrating portfolio assignments into the curriculum is an effective strategy for developing question design skills among prospective PAI teachers.

Abstract

This study examines school culture's in creating an inclusive environment that supports diversity. This study uses a qualitative approach with a case study type at SD Negeri 03 Pontianak City. Data collection techniques include observation and interviews with the principal and Islamic Religious Education (PAI) teachers. The results of the study indicate that school culture contributes to creating an inclusive environment through three main aspects: (1) School cultural artefacts, such as the use of traditional clothing in school activities, classroom decorations that reflect cultural diversity, and equal religious learning facilities; (2) Values ​​and beliefs that are manifested through inclusive school rules, the formation of the Violence Prevention and Handling Team (TPPK), and the integration of regional languages ​​in learning to strengthen students' cultural identity; and (3) Basic assumptions reflected in cultural activities such as the robo-robo tradition and the celebration of the culmination of the sun, as well as the integration of multicultural values ​​in the curriculum. Implementing this school culture has built multicultural awareness in an inclusive environment, becoming a model for other schools in instilling tolerance and solidarity among students.

Abstract

In recent times, sex education has become an urgent matter to be conveyed, considering the many cases of sexual violence targeting children, especially in educational institutions. This community service was conducted at two State Elementary Schools in Tanjunganom Nganjuk. The CBR method has four stages: laying the foundation, planning, information gathering and analysis and acting on findings. This community service shows the results that sex education at Tanjunganom Elementary School is carried out through three strategic steps; the first is collaboration, which is carried out together with KKG PAI Tanjunganom. Second is material construction, namely determining the material adopted through underware rules, which is then integrated with Islamic education. Third, stimulus provision, namely in the form of a competition with the theme My Body is My Own and Good Secret and Bad Secret. In the implementation of sex education, it can significantly increase students' knowledge. The implementation of sex education cannot be separated from the provision of material about Islamic morals. In addition, sex education at the Elementary School level, which is carried out through various methods, must also be balanced with discussions and lectures as an actualization of the construction of material in children's memories. This form of education is an effective preventive step in reducing the number of cases of sexual violence.

Abstract

This study aims to integrate the concept of ta'dib, which emphasizes the formation of manners, morals, and ethics as proposed by Syed Naquib al-Attas, with the 5S program (Smile, Greeting, Greeting, Polite, Courteous) in the context of character education at SMK ICB Cinta Niaga. A qualitative approach with a case study design was used to explore the implementation of this program and its impact on student character building. Data were collected through interviews, observations, and document analysis, then analyzed using NVivo12 software. The results show that ta'dib values in the 5S program can enhance various aspects of students' character development, particularly in improving students' social interactions (such as mutual respect and cooperation among peers), fostering harmonious teacher-student relationships (through enhanced communication and mutual appreciation), and strengthening the habituation of positive behaviors (such as discipline, responsibility, and empathy). Ta'dib values are reflected in simple yet meaningful habits that support holistic character building in accordance with Islamic values. This finding confirms the relevance of ta'dib in modern education to answer the challenges of globalization. However, this study has limitations in the limited scope of the school, so the generalization of the results of this study is a challenge. Further research is recommended to expand the scope of locations and use a mixed-method approach to deepen the analysis and produce more comprehensive findings.

Abstract

This study aims to describe the role of early childhood education (PAUD) institutions in instilling religious moderation values ​​in early-age students. This study uses a field research type in Mutiara Bunda PAUD, Witri State Kindergarten, Harapan Bangsa PAUD, Kusuma Wangi PAUD and Tarbiyatul Atfal PAUD, Air Periukan District, Seluma Regency, Bengkulu. The targets of this study were school principals, teachers, and education personnel. The results of the study indicate that the role of PAUD principals in decision-making is carried out through discussion; providing innovation by initiating school programs; providing motivation to teachers and students; and providing rewards. The role of teachers consists of motivating by telling stories; reminding the 5S motto, using Indonesian in schools; managing the learning environment; providing rewards; and guiding moderate attitudes. The role of educators consists of managing student admissions; preparing administration books, school programs, teacher training programs; and evaluating educational development and coaching activities in instilling religious moderation values ​​in children in schools.

Abstract

The phenomenon of gender inequality in pesantren education stands as a significant challenge, especially related to the low participation of female students, which results in inequality in learning opportunities. A solution is needed through a systematic approach to strengthen gender education equality to create a more just and inclusive environment for all students. This study describes the challenges and strengths of gender equality education at Hasyim Asy'ari Jepara Islamic Boarding School. This qualitative research uses the case study method. Data collection used interview techniques with caregivers, teachers, and students, observation of pesantren activities, and document analysis. The results showed that the reinforcement of gender equality education was carried out by implementing an inclusive curriculum and participatory learning methods, thus providing equal opportunities for male and female santri. Second, training for teachers and students should be organized. Third, providing opportunities for female santri participation. Fourth, continuous evaluation. The results of this study are expected to be an example for other pesantren who apply the principles of gender equality that are fair and inclusive to create a supportive educational environment for all students.

Abstract

Islamic boarding schools (pondok pesantren) not only focus on religious studies but also on social and economic empowerment. This study explores human resource management (HRM) strategies at Pondok Pesantren An Nur using a qualitative approach through observation, interviews, and document analysis. The findings indicate that the pesantren has a well-organized organizational structure, systematic work programs, and efforts to enhance the competence of ustadz through training and missionary assignments (dakwah). The management of santri is conducted through practice-based education, spiritual discipline, and skill development in the fields of dakwah and organization. Additionally, the pesantren’s relationships with the community and external institutions play a role in strengthening its social impact and program sustainability. However, challenges such as suboptimal coordination and limited resources remain. The study implies that integrating Islamic values with modern management approaches can create a more adaptive and competitive pesantren. The indicators of success include the effectiveness of work programs, improvement in the quality of ustadz and santri, and the strengthening of external networks. This research contributes by providing insights for pesantren administrators in developing innovative HRM strategies and for academics in understanding the dynamics of pesantren as educational and community empowerment institutions.

Abstract

This study explores the delivery of Al-Qur'an learning, focusing on using the talaqqi method for Senior High School (SMA) students. Although the talaqqi method is considered traditional, its approach can be adapted to current conditions and technological developments through an integrative strategy that combines both conventional and progressive aspects. This study employs a descriptive qualitative research method at the Darul Rahman Integrated Islamic Senior High School (SMAIT) in Tempuling District, Indragiri Hilir Regency, Riau. Data were collected through interviews with school principals, Al-Qur'an teachers, and Islamic Religious Education (PAI) teachers and through observations. They were analyzed using an interactive analysis model. The results indicate that the process of Al-Qur'an learning using the talaqqi method is conducted by adapting cooperative learning, taking place collaboratively with holistic cooperation, namely partnerships between schools and the community. Second, the learning process incorporates various types of technology and learning media in an integrated manner, combining conventional and digital aspects to accommodate diverse student learning styles. In conclusion, the talaqqi method can be effectively adapted to contemporary educational contexts through cooperative learning and technology integration. This study implies that schools should foster stronger partnerships with parents and the community and develop teacher competencies in using conventional and digital learning media to enhance students' learning experiences.
Intelligence Components, Learning Agility Quotient, and Work Readiness of Indonesian Islamic Education Graduates in Industry 4.0 Mardiana, Dina

Abstract

Integrating Islamic education with Industry 4.0 (IR4.0) presents significant challenges for graduates preparing to enter the workforce. This study aims to analyze the relationships between intelligence components (technology literacy, professional knowledge, critical thinking, problem-solving skills), learning agility quotient, and work readiness of Indonesian Islamic education graduates in the IR4.0 environment and to examine the mediating role of learning agility in these relationships. Using a quantitative cross-sectional approach, data were collected from 182 final-year Islamic education program students (96.2% aged 22-25 years; 73.1% female) and analyzed using partial least squares structural equation modeling (PLS-SEM). Results indicate that technology literacy (β=0.438, p<0.001) and problem-solving skills (β=0.345, p<0.001) positively influence learning agility, while critical thinking demonstrates an unexpected negative relationship (β=-0.229, p<0.001). Learning agility positively influences work readiness (β=0.258, p<0.001) and significantly mediates the relationships between technology literacy, problem-solving skills, critical thinking, and work readiness. These findings highlight the importance of developing learning agility as a linking mechanism between cognitive capabilities and work readiness and imply that Islamic education institutions should strengthen technology literacy and problem-solving skills while developing approaches that balance traditional values with adaptive learning capabilities to prepare graduates for the complex demands of the IR4.0 era.
